Screen printing inspector gender statistics

63.2% of screen printing inspectors are women and 36.8% of screen printing inspectors are men.

Screen printing inspector gender pay gap

Women earn 88¢ for every $1 earned by men

male-income
Male income
$42,629
female-income
Female income
$37,305

Screen printing inspector demographics by race

The most common ethnicity among screen printing inspectors is White, which makes up 61.4% of all screen printing inspectors. Comparatively, 16.6% of screen printing inspectors are Hispanic or Latino and 9.6% of screen printing inspectors are Black or African American.
  • White, 61.4%
  • Hispanic or Latino, 16.6%
  • Black or African American, 9.6%
  • Asian, 7.5%
  • Unknown, 4.2%
  • American Indian and Alaska Native, 0.7%

Screen printing inspector wage gap by race

According to our data, asian screen printing inspectors have the highest average salary compared to other ethnicities. Black or african american screen printing inspectors have the lowest average salary at $40,792.

Screen printing inspector wage gap by degree level

According to the data, screen printing inspectors with a Master's degree earn more than those without, at $53,428 annually. With a Bachelor's degree, screen printing inspectors earn a median annual income of $44,938 compared to $40,786 for screen printing inspectors with an Associate degree.
